### DJI Fly vs Litchi for DJI Drones — Head to Head
- **[Litchi for DJI Drones](https://marlvel.ai/intel-report/photo-video/com-flylitchi-litchi)** by VC Technology Ltd: Litchi serves as the primary third-party flight control alternative for DJI users, offering advanced autonomous flight modes that the official DJI Fly app intentionally limits.
  - **Moat strength:** High — sustainable advantage over 12 months
  - **Key differences:**
    - Provides advanced waypoint mission planning and autonomous flight paths missing from the standard DJI Fly interface.
    - Offers VR mode and focus tracking capabilities that cater to professional prosumer drone operators.
    - Maintains a long-standing reputation as the go-to utility for complex flight automation and mission execution.
  - **Where DJI Fly wins:**
    - ✅ Native integration ensures seamless firmware compatibility and immediate support for the newest DJI drone hardware releases.
    - ✅ Intuitive UI design lowers the barrier to entry for casual flyers and new drone enthusiasts.
  - **Where Litchi for DJI Drones wins:**
    - ❌ Advanced waypoint mission planning allows for complex, repeatable autonomous flight paths beyond basic manual control.
    - ❌ Third-party flexibility enables specialized flight modes like FPV and orbit tracking that DJI restricts for safety.
  - **Verdict:** The target app should focus on simplifying the onboarding experience for casual users while Litchi captures the power-user segment through advanced mission automation.
